WebThe reproductive cycle of female dogs in heat has four stages, like pregnancy: The first stage of a dog’s heat cycle is called proestrus and typically lasts between 7 and 10 days. Vulvar edema and bleeding are the initial symptoms. The dog is still not sexually mature and so unable to have puppies at this time. WebSep 12, 2024 · Female dogs can be in heat for about two or three weeks, with some females having a “silent” heat. ©Nancy Kerns. Intact (unsprayed) female dogs will typically have their first heat cycle two to three months after they reach their full adult size. For smaller breed dogs, this is typically between 6 and 8 months of age but could be as early ... WebMany neutered dogs (especially if neutered after they reach maturity at 18 months or so) will still follow and indeed attempt to mate with a female in heat. They will have a reduced drive to mate due to the removal of some of the testosterone-producing organs, but some dogs will indeed still try. Can a […] WebMay 23, 2024 · Dog In Heat: Summary.
